OnePlus 9R 256GB Pros & Cons
Pros
- Has a good 120Hz Fluid AMOLED display and a good design
- Cameras are good
- Snapdragon 870 delivers great performance and 5G capabilities
- Comes with a large 4500mAh battery and warp charging
- Has an in-display fingerprint sensor
Cons
- Doesn't support memory cards
- No 3.5mm headphone jack
Apple iPhone 12 256GB Pros & Cons
Pros
- Beautiful OLED display
- Powerful battery
- 5G support
Cons
- Unexpandable storage
